_____ he likes the sounds of nature, Tan uses them a lot in his music.Since As Since and as are also used to give reasons for something.
Usually the reasons are already known.
Their tone is weaker than because.
Since and as are used in the same way and have no difference in meaning.Working out the rulesPracticeAn art festival Daniel decided to play the violin at the art festival since/as he is good at it.1. Daniel decided to play the violin at the art festival. He is good at it.
